![]() |
![]() |
| Paypal | F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
|||||||
|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Buscar | Temas de Hoy | Marcar Foros Como Leídos |
![]() |
|
|
Herramientas | Buscar en Tema | Desplegado |
|
|
|
#1
|
||||
|
||||
|
¿Cómo haces este proceso?...
Si lo haces con un dataset, prueba poniendo este como Unidirectional = True... Saludos!
__________________
delphi.com.ar Dedique el tiempo suficiente para formular su pregunta si pretende que alguien dedique su tiempo en contestarla.
|
|
#2
|
|||
|
|||
|
Uso un componente TTable que creo no tiene esa propiedad.
Deberia usar un Tquery ?
__________________
Balda |
|
#3
|
||||
|
||||
|
Porqué no nos cuentas mejor cómo estas haciendo este proceso... (Cómo lees la tabla, como insertas los registros)
¿No puedes hacer un INSERT de un SELECT?
__________________
delphi.com.ar Dedique el tiempo suficiente para formular su pregunta si pretende que alguien dedique su tiempo en contestarla.
|
|
#4
|
|||
|
|||
|
ok , paso a detallar
Tengo dos TTables conectados a un Tdatabase. Leo de principio a fin el ttable1 y por cada registro hago insert y post en el ttable2. No utilizo ningun tquery. Otra duda que se me plantes es si usar una transaccion en un procedimiento en donde se graben tantos registros. Espero haber sido claro. Gracias.
__________________
Balda |
|
#5
|
|||
|
|||
|
Si las dos tablas son de Interbase y están en la misma Base de Datos, yo probaría con un procedimiento almacenado.
Tambien te recomiendo desactivar índices para el proceso y luego volverlos a activar |
|
#6
|
|||
|
|||
|
Reemplaze el insert/post del ttable por un sql-insert sobre un tquery, coloque la propiedad unidirectional a false y la velocidad aumento
notablemente. Muchas gracias por la guia ofrecida. Nuevamente me sacaron de dudas.
__________________
Balda |
|
#7
|
||||
|
||||
|
Tal y como apuntaba d.c.a, puedes hacer algo asi como:
Código:
INSERT INTO TABLA2 (CAMPO1, CAMPO2, ..., CAMPON) VALUES (SELECT CAMPO1, CAMPO2, ..., CAMPON FROM TABLA2 WHERE CONDICION)
__________________
E pur si muove |
![]() |
| Herramientas | Buscar en Tema |
| Desplegado | |
|
|
|